What Are Non-GamStop Gambling Sites?
Non-GamStop gambling sites are online casinos that are not registered with the GamStop self-exclusion scheme. While GamStop aims to help players manage their gambling habits by allowing them to self-exclude from all UK gambling sites registered with it, non-GamStop sites provide an alternative for those who wish to continue playing without restrictions. These platforms are often licensed in jurisdictions outside the UK and offer a wide array of gambling options, including slots, table games, and live dealer experiences.

The Risks Involved
Despite the appealing features of non-GamStop gambling sites, players should also be aware of the associated risks:

- Less Regulation: These sites may not adhere to the same regulatory standards as those under GamStop, which can impact player safety and fairness.
- Increased Vulnerability: For players who struggle with gambling addiction, accessing these sites can exacerbate their issues, as they are not subject to the self-exclusion measures of GamStop.
- Limited Support Resources: Non-GamStop sites may lack the comprehensive support resources necessary for players who need help with gambling-related issues.
